New tax to take effect April 1

The Patrick County Board of Supervisors on Feb. 10, approved a Prepared Food and Beverage Tax Ordinance with an effective date of April 1, 2020.

Any prepared food and beverages as described in the ordinance sold within the county should begin to collect the 4% tax beginning April 1; payments are due each month.

The ordinance exempts some organizations for the first $100,000 sold. Among exempt organizations are fire departments, rescue squads, nonprofit churches, educational, charitable, and others. A complete list is included in the ordinance, or for more information, contact the Commissioner of the Revenue’s office.

A copy of the ordinance can be viewed online at www.co.patrick.va.us under ordinances.

Any business, caterer, vendor, organization or individual selling prepared food and beverages to the public in in the county that did not receive an information packet from the Commissioner of the Revenue also is encouraged to call the office at (276) 694-7131.
